When an image quality problem occurs during printing, output a sample print to determine and grasp the
nature of the problem and take proper steps, and then perform a troubleshooting efficiently using "3.2 Image
Quality Troubleshooting".
If the problem persists even after the troubleshooting with the Image Quality Troubleshooting, check using the
Image Quality Troubleshooting again, and then replace the "Possible causative parts" listed in the Image
Quality Troubleshooting one by one, and also perform the troubleshooting using "Chapter 6 General" and others.

NOTE
When horizontal lines and/or spot occur periodically, it is possibly caused by the trouble of a particular roll.
In this case, compare the trouble intervals on the test print with the Pitch Chart. The interval does not necessarily match circumference of the roll. The trouble may be solved easily by the check.
